Motspur Park station embodies simplicity with its essential facilities. The ticket office offers limited service hours, from 06:30 to 13:00 on weekdays and slightly reduced hours over the weekend. However, don't fret if you miss the ticket office; ticket machines are available and allow the collection of pre-purchased tickets. For those with accessibility needs, these machines are capable of processing Disabled Persons Railcard discounts and are user-friendly.
While the station doesn’t boast extensive support or customer information services, passengers can rely on customer help points and CCTV for enhanced security. It's worth noting that staff help is not available at the station itself, so assistance for boarding is typically offered onboard by the train guards.
A key consideration for travelers is the station's lack of step-free access, making it somewhat challenging for those with mobility impairments. While ramps for train access are present, travelers requiring assistance are advised to plan and communicate their needs in advance via the South Western Railway’s booking services.
Connecting to other modes of transport from Motspur Park is straightforward, with Claremont Avenue serving as a pick-up point for rail replacement services. While the station itself lacks bus services, detailed onward travel planning is available for those looking to catch a bus from the surrounding areas. Additionally, cycling amenities include eight bicycle racks, though these are unsheltered and not monitored by CCTV.

Broad Green Station, while currently closed for refurbishment until Winter 2024, is normally well-equipped with various facilities designed to ensure a comfortable journey. The station features a ticket office with extensive opening hours and provides ticket machines that allow passengers to not only buy tickets but also collect those purchased online. Smart card issuance and validation facilities further enhance the convenience for tech-savvy travellers.
Access to information and help is a priority here, with help points and departure screens readily available. While there's no waiting room, seating areas are accessible for many tired feet. Though lacking in refreshment options and shops, the nearby area compensates with local amenities. Make sure to plan accordingly, as the toilets and baby changing facilities are not available on-site.
Understanding the importance of providing comprehensive access, Broad Green Station offers partial step-free access, and ramps are available for train boarding. For passengers needing assistance, it is advisable to book through Passenger Assist, which allows arrangements up to two hours before traveling. Unfortunately, there are no accessible toilets or dedicated pick-up points, emphasizing the need for pre-travel arrangements if required.
If your journey requires connections to other modes of transport, Broad Green has you covered. Rail replacement services and local bus links outside the station connect you further afield, with options to journey towards Liverpool at the Turnpike Tavern or Warrington directly from the bus stop at the station entrance. For those preferring the privacy of a taxi, the online service Cab4You is a convenient choice.
Cyclists will also find limited bicycle storage, complete with CCTV for added peace of mind. Do note that cycle hire isn't available at the station, so bring your own if you're planning to pedal your way around the locale.
